St. Lawrence University invites applications for a one-year Visiting Assistant Professor position in Film & Francophone Studies, with a specialization in any non-European francophone area, and the ability to teach all levels of French language. This position has the potential to be renewed for additional year(s) . The successful candidate will teach 3 courses per semester, including French language courses, topics in Francophone cinema in both English and French, as well as Introduction to Film Studies to support St. Lawrence’s interdisciplinary program in Digital Media & Film. We are especially interested in candidates with a focus on the critical study of gender, sexuality, and race in cinematic representation and a commitment to exploring the changing meaning and function of cinema in relation to emerging digital technologies. The position is a dual appointment between the new program in Digital Media & Film and the Department of World Languages, Cultures and Media.
